“Aprendendo Algoritmos: Repetições Simples e Aninhadas no 4º Ano”

Tema: Algoritmos com repetições simples e aninhadas
Etapa/Série: 4º ano
Disciplina: Educação Tecnológica
Questões: 5

Prova: Algoritmos com Repetições Simples e Aninhadas

Aluno(a): __________________________

Data: ____/____/______

Planejamentos de Aula BNCC Infantil e Fundamental

Instruções:

Responda às questões a seguir, utilizando uma linguagem clara e organizada. Certifique-se de justificar suas respostas quando solicitado.

Questões:

Questão 1:

Imagine que você precisa lavar as janelas de um prédio que possui 10 andares, sendo que cada andar possui 20 janelas. Elabore um algoritmo simples, descrevendo as etapas necessárias para realizar essa tarefa. Considere o conceito de algoritmo e repetições simples.

Questão 2:

Descreva o que são algoritmos com repetições aninhadas. Em sua explicação, inclua um exemplo prático de situações do cotidiano que possam ser representadas por esse tipo de algoritmo.

Questão 3:

Pense em um algoritmo que você poderia usar para organizar uma festa na escola. Quais seriam as atividades repetitivas que você incluiria no seu algoritmo? Trace um exemplo de um algoritmo com pelo menos uma repetição simples e outra aninhada e justifique a escolha dessas atividades.

Questão 4:

Considere o seguinte cenário: um grupo de amigos decidiu coletar tampinhas de garrafa para uma campanha de reciclagem e pretende coletar 30 tampinhas por dia durante 5 dias. Escreva um algoritmo que represente essa atividade. Que repetições ele possui? Justifique.

Questão 5:

Agora, pense em uma tarefa que você já fez e que envolveu a repetição de ações, como fazer a lição de casa ou arrumar o quarto. Como você organizaria as etapas dessa tarefa em um algoritmo que utilize repetições simples e aninhadas? Descreva sua solução e explique como isso facilita a execução da tarefa.

Gabarito:

Questão 1:

O aluno deve apresentar um algoritmo que descreve as seguintes etapas:

  • Começar a lavar janelas
  • Para cada andar de 1 a 10:
    • Para cada janela de 1 a 20:
    • Lavar uma janela

  • Fim

Justificativa: O aluno deve explicar que a repetição simples se refere a lavar as 20 janelas a cada andar e a repetição aninhada refere-se à repetição da tarefa no contexto dos andares.

Questão 2:

O aluno deve explicar que algoritmos com repetições aninhadas são aqueles em que uma instrução de repetição contém outra instrução de repetição. Por exemplo, durante a preparação do lanche, repetir a tarefa de fazer 5 sanduíches em 3 etapas (cortar, montar e embalar). Cada etapa pode ser vista como uma repetição.

Questão 3:

Os alunos podem propor atividades como: convidar amigos, preparar comidas, organizar jogos, etc. O algoritmo deve incluir:

  • Para cada amigo convidado:
  • Preparar comida
  • Organizar jogos

A justificativa deve ressaltar o processo de planejamento que facilita a organização da festa.

Questão 4:

Um algoritmo adequado poderia ser:

  • Começar a coleta de tampinhas
  • Para cada dia de 1 a 5:
  • Coletar 30 tampinhas
  • Fim

A justificativa se refere à repetição de coletar tampinhas que ocorre diariamente e o ciclo de dias representa uma repetição aninhada caso o aluno especifique atividades diárias durante a coleta.

Questão 5:

Um exemplo de algoritmo pode ser:

  • Arrumar o quarto
  • Para cada tipo de item (brinquedos, roupas, livros):
  • Reorganizar os itens
  • Para cada item das categorias:
  • Colocar no lugar certo
  • Fim

Os alunos devem explicar que a repetição simples consiste na organização dos tipos de itens e a aninhada na organização de cada item de cada tipo, facilitando a tarefa de arrumação.

Estas questões estimulam tanto a compreensão básica sobre algoritmos quanto o raciocínio lógico e crítico, conforme as diretrizes da BNCC para a Educação Tecnológica.


Botões de Compartilhamento Social